如果您能帮助我解决问题,那就太好了。
我正在使用Bootstrap滑块(https://seiyria.com/bootstrap-slider/)。
我要显示当前滑块值。
它与逗号一起使用。如何将','->'更改为'
Age Range ...<br/>
<b>18</b> <span><input id="ex2" type="text" class="span2" value="" data-slider-min="18" data-slider-max="100" data-slider-step="1" data-slider-value="[30,55]"/></span> <b>100</b><br/>
<span id="ageSliderLabel">Current Slider Value: <span id="ageSliderVal">30,55</span></span>
<!-- Bootstrap Slider -->
<link href="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-slider/10.2.1/css/bootstrap-slider.css" rel="stylesheet">
<script src="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-slider/10.2.1/bootstrap-slider.js"></script>
<script>
var slider = new Slider('#ex2', {});
slider.on("slide", function(sliderValue) {
document.getElementById("ageSliderVal").textContent = sliderValue;
});
</script>
答案 0 :(得分:1)
document.getElementById("ageSliderVal").textContent = sliderValue.replace(",", " to ")
答案 1 :(得分:0)
不幸的是,它对我不起作用。
我必须将代码与反斜杠集成到php中,然后再无任何作用。
var slide = new Slider('#ex2',{}); slide.on(\“ slide \”,function(sliderValue){ document.getElementById(\“ ageSliderVal \”)。textContent = slideValue.replace(\“,\”,\“到\”) });
答案 2 :(得分:0)
我有解决办法。
使用toString()后可以使用
<script>
var slider = new Slider('#ex2', {});
slider.on("slide", function(sliderValue) {
var sliderValue = sliderValue.toString();
document.getElementById("ageSliderVal").textContent = sliderValue.replace(",", " to ")
});
</script>